MACS provides 24/7 supported housing for young people leaving care who are aged between 16 and 21. Young people can live with us for up to 2 years before moving into the community. Support Workers provide an accessible point of contact at night and weekends to promote the protection and safeguarding of young people living at MACS and help them to build skills and confidence to maintain their own homes. Moore Concrete’s Apprenticeship Programme is an opportunity that we pride ourselves in offering to young students studying all levels of apprenticeships, providing them with the platform to upskill, develop their knowledge and gain relevant work experience alongside their studies. We were finalists in the CIPD NI Best Apprenticeship Scheme Category, which is a great testament to the work and dedication that goes into developing and supporting our apprentices. We have an on-site Apprentice Mentor who is available for unlimited support and guidance, as well as quarterly Apprentice Reviews to grasp a deeper understanding of what our Apprentices have learnt and how else we can accommodate them to help grow their technical ability within their role. We are offering joinery apprenticeships which will combine on-the-job learning with study and put the apprentice on the path to gaining a recognised qualification whilst gaining valuable experience in a busy joinery workshop. The successful candidate will complete in-house training to become a joiner/mould maker as part of our joinery team in the manufacturing of timber moulds for our civil engineering projects.
